Magnesium in PDB 3ryc: Tubulin: RB3 Stathmin-Like Domain Complex

Protein crystallography data

The structure of Tubulin: RB3 Stathmin-Like Domain Complex, PDB code: 3ryc was solved by A.Nawrotek, M.Knossow, B.Gigant,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 43.14 / 2.10
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 66.450, 127.240, 250.340, 90.00, 90.00, 90.00
R / Rfree (%) 17.1 / 20.1

Magnesium Binding Sites:

The binding sites of Magnesium atom in the Tubulin: RB3 Stathmin-Like Domain Complex (pdb code 3ryc). This binding sites where shown within 5.0 Angstroms radius around Magnesium atom.
In total 3 binding sites of Magnesium where determined in the Tubulin: RB3 Stathmin-Like Domain Complex, PDB code: 3ryc:
